On Wed, Mar 13, 2013 at 6:16 AM, Eric Covener <cove...@gmail.com> wrote: > On Wed, Mar 13, 2013 at 6:01 AM, Hoang Vu Dang <dang....@gmail.com> wrote: >> Hi guys, >> >> Is there any limit of the size of a message log entry? How to control this ? >> >> I did this: >> >> ap_log_rerror(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_INFO, 0, f->r, >> "%s", buffer); >> >> And the buffer was truncated on the error log. I check the strlen of the >> buffer and it was about 320K, and I got only around: ~ 8KB > > If it's more than PIPE_BUF, it won't be atomic and can be interleaved > with other entries. Are you sure it's truncated and not just spread > out?
Er if using a piped logger that is.
